ST. JOHNS EPISCOPAL HOSPITAL COMMUNITY BOARD INSTALLS NEW OFFICERS
(JUNE 14, 2010) Far Rockaway, NY - - - The Community Advisory Board of St.
John's Episcopal Hospital installed a new slate of officers at its annual
dinner meeting on Wednesday, June 9, 2010. The keynote speaker was Sanford
M. Bernstein, General Manager of The Wave, who gave the history of the
newspaper, as well as its editorial philosophy and tips on submitting
stories.
John Gupta, Chief Executive Officer of St. John's, spoke on the
state of the Hospital. Kathleen LeCadre, member of the Board of Managers of
Episcopal Health Services, St. John's parent organization, administered the
oath of office to the new officers and to all the members of the Advisory
Board. The newly elected officers are: Rachel D. Forde, President;
Christina Russell, 1st Vice President; Anthony LaFerrara, 2nd Vice
President; Juana Cabrera-Bodre, 3rd Vice President; and Cliff Russell,
Secretary.
